International Cricket Can Help Open Up Markets For Malaysian Airline COs

KUALA LUMPUR, July 7 (Bernama) -- International cricket can help open up new markets for Malaysian airline companies, according to the Malaysian Cricket Association. "This is especially so by creating a brand presence in key markets of the sport with a combined population of 1.5 billion. "In terms of tourism, it is a huge opportunity as airlines are at the cutting edge of this development," the association's president, Mahinda Vallipuram said in a statement Tuesday. The statement was issued following Malindo Air's recent confirmation of its involvement in the Nepal Earthquake Fund Raising Match and the "Bat for Nepal" campaign. The sponsorship agreement was reached during a recent working visit to Kuala Lumpur by the Chief Executive Officer of the Cricket Association of Nepal, Bhawana Ghimire. Nepal's national team will be flown in by Malindo Air for the match, to be held at the Kinrara Oval in Kuala Lumpur, next month. "Malindo Air is an important industry player and we are proud to have them on board as the official airline for the fund raiser. "This is not only a sponsorship but an important contribution at a time when it is most needed for the people of Nepal," Mahinda said. The Nepalese team will take on a World XI comprising some of the great names of the game. Tickets can be purchased at the Kinrara Oval and all proceeds from the sale will be channelled to Nepal's Prime Minister Disaster Relief Fund. Malindo Air operates 14 weekly flights between Kathmandu and Kuala Lumpur. For more information, visit www.cricketmalaysia.com. --BERNAMA
